I had a first date in Disney World! LOL never in my wildest dreams would I have ever imagined this happening.

I met a guy on the WDW Railroad on the first day of my solo trip, we hit it off and we learned that we live in the same city... so he told me he'd love to take me out for drinks some time, I said sure and we exchanged numbers. When we got off the train, he asked if I wanted some company so he left his group of friends and we strolled around MK... after about an hour, he was like screw drinks, wanna go out for dinner tomorrow? I said sure!

I had just gotten out of a really long relationship, which kinda prompted my trip to WDW and I was thinking "omg, is this really happening?"

We met up at Downtown Disney.... went to the T-rex restaurant, got to know each other a bit, strolled along the strip and he was really interested in taking me to LaNouba and I was thinking oh wow, this guy's serious... but unfortunately they have no shows Monday evenings. We said our good byes, we went to our own resorts and he left to go back home the following day.

We kept in touch via email for the duration of my trip... once I got back home, we chatted on the phone for 2 weeks and he kept insisting on a 2nd date and he was really into me but he's a smoker (that's a HUGE turn off to me) and I don't think I'm ready to date at the moment... but c'mon who would've passed on a date in Disney World?! MAGICAL.

A day at a Disney park is a great first date idea (though a bit pricey unless you both have passes). It's been proven that a little thrill like a roller coaster helps people bond and have positive feelings toward each other.

Plus, think of how well you can get to know someone in a theme park. Are they laid-back or a commando? Do they chase every thrill or do they like the view from the slow lane? Do they buy every trinket and churro or are they more conservative? Are they patient enough to wait in a long line and resilient enough to roll with the punches if a ride breaks down? Are they too-cool-for-school or a big kid and proud of it?
